Recap of March 29th to April 1st

ELA - Student have been working on reading words with 4 letter sounds per word. The words begin or end with consonant clusters. For example: the "st" in "stop" or the "sw" in "swim"

Students have started reading through our new classroom reader book "Kit" they are working to read the stories "Kit" and "Kit and Stan" These are stories that contain words the students can all decode on their own.

Math- Students are continuing to work on solving addition sentences. Students are using various strategies like using a number line, drawing a picture, and using a tens frame.

Bible Study - Students studied the stories of Holy Week including Palm Sunday, The Last supper, Jesus Praying in the Garden, and Jesus being Arrested. Students will learn the rest of the story this week.

Science - Students are learning about how to take care of the Earth. Lately we have been learning about how to reduce, reuse, and recycle.

Art - Students created stained glass cross pictures to bring home to decorate for the Easter Holiday.
